Margrit
Also spelled: Margaret, Margareta, Marguerite, Margarita, Greta, Gretel
Pronunciation: MAHR-grit
Meaning
Pearl
Origin
Greek (via Latin and Germanic)
About Margrit
Margrit offers a refreshing take on a timeless classic, carrying the inherent elegance and traditional appeal of its "pearl" meaning with a distinctive Germanic twist. This name is perfect for parents who appreciate the deep roots and classic sensibility of names like Margaret but are seeking something less common and more intriguing. While it shares the same beloved origin as many European variants, Margrit stands out as a less-traveled path, offering a subtle nod to its heritage without feeling overly ornate. It evokes an image of quiet strength and refined beauty, a name that will age gracefully alongside its bearer.

Frequently Asked Questions About Margrit
What is the origin of the name Margrit?
Margrit has roots in Greek, Latin, and Germanic traditions, ultimately deriving from the word for "pearl." It carries strong biblical and Christian associations.
Are there any common nicknames for Margrit?
Yes, Margrit shares many common nicknames with its longer forms, such as Greta and Gretel, as well as Margaret, Margareta, Marguerite, and Margarita.
